Index

A B C D G H I N O P R S T U V 
All Classes and Interfaces|All Packages

A

aggregationTemporality() - Method in interface io.micrometer.registry.otlp.OtlpConfig
AggregationTemporality of the OtlpMeterRegistry.
AggregationTemporality - Enum Class in io.micrometer.registry.otlp
AggregationTemporality defines the way additive values are expressed.

B

baseTimeUnit() - Method in interface io.micrometer.registry.otlp.OtlpConfig
 

C

close() -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
CUMULATIVE - Enum constant in enum class io.micrometer.registry.otlp.AggregationTemporality
Reported values incorporate previous measurements.

D

DEFAULT - Static variable in interface io.micrometer.registry.otlp.OtlpConfig
Configuration with default values.
defaultHistogramConfig() -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
DELTA - Enum constant in enum class io.micrometer.registry.otlp.AggregationTemporality
Reported values do not incorporate previous measurements.

G

getBaseTimeUnit() -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 

H

headers() - Method in interface io.micrometer.registry.otlp.OtlpConfig
Additional headers to send with exported metrics.

I

io.micrometer.registry.otlp - package io.micrometer.registry.otlp
 

N

newCounter(Meter.Id)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newDistributionSummary(Meter.Id, DistributionStatisticConfig, double)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newFunctionCounter(Meter.Id, T, ToDoubleFunction<T>)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newFunctionTimer(Meter.Id, T, ToLongFunction<T>, ToDoubleFunction<T>, TimeUnit)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newGauge(Meter.Id, T, ToDoubleFunction<T>)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newLongTaskTimer(Meter.Id, DistributionStatisticConfig)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newMeter(Meter.Id, Meter.Type, Iterable<Measurement>)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
newTimer(Meter.Id, DistributionStatisticConfig, PauseDetector)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 

O

OtlpConfig - Interface in io.micrometer.registry.otlp
Config for OtlpMeterRegistry.
OtlpMeterRegistry - Class in io.micrometer.registry.otlp
Publishes meters in OTLP (OpenTelemetry Protocol) format.
OtlpMeterRegistry() - Constructor for class io.micrometer.registry.otlp.OtlpMeterRegistry
 
OtlpMeterRegistry(OtlpConfig, Clock) - Constructor for class io.micrometer.registry.otlp.OtlpMeterRegistry
 

P

prefix() - Method in interface io.micrometer.registry.otlp.OtlpConfig
 
publish() -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 

R

resourceAttributes() - Method in interface io.micrometer.registry.otlp.OtlpConfig
Attributes to set on the Resource that will be used for all metrics published.

S

start(ThreadFactory) -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 
stop() - Method in class io.micrometer.registry.otlp.OtlpMeterRegistry
 

T

toOtlpAggregationTemporality(AggregationTemporality) - Static method in enum class io.micrometer.registry.otlp.AggregationTemporality
 

U

url() - Method in interface io.micrometer.registry.otlp.OtlpConfig
Defaults to http://localhost:4318/v1/metrics

V

validate() - Method in interface io.micrometer.registry.otlp.OtlpConfig
 
valueOf(String) - Static method in enum class io.micrometer.registry.otlp.AggregationTemporality
Returns the enum constant of this class with the specified name.
values() - Static method in enum class io.micrometer.registry.otlp.AggregationTemporality
Returns an array containing the constants of this enum class, in the order they are declared.
A B C D G H I N O P R S T U V 
All Classes and Interfaces|All Packages